dc.description.abstractOpening statement by K.Y. Amoako Executive Secretary of the Economic Commission for Africa (ECA at the 7th African Regional Conference on Women Ministerial Conference on the Decade Review of the Implementation of the Dakar and Beijing Platforms for Action. Mr. Amoako, on his remarks highlighted that, the gender movement gained momentum after every conference. Altogether they created a climate of legitimacy, for gender movements and gender reform, which otherwise would have taken much longer to achieve. A remarkable wealth of talent has prepared for these Ministerial meetings. The growth in achievements across this continent provides a broader base of real experience to compare and to provide peer learning. It is expected to recommend actions, across all levels of government and all components of societies.
